LMO Description
Organisation Instituto Geográfico Português
Details
Level of authority National
Formal Mandate Responsible for the National Geodetic Network and Cadastre. The Institute is a National reference on Catrography, and the official co-ordinator for the National System of Geographical Information, the Portuguese Spatial Data Infrastructure.
Main Activities - The official licensing organisation on cartography production;
- Provides the guidelines for cadastre execution in Portugal;
- Also responsible for cadastre execution and update;
- Responsible for the geodetic network;
- Co-ordinator of the National Spatial Data Infrastructure;
- Research and development in the field of geographical information science (in the fields of the environment, remote sensing, emergencies and land planning).

Previous Experience relevant for INSPIRE development The institute has inherited the competences of the National Centre of Geographical Information, which has implemented the National SDI in the country, launched on the web in 1995. The Institute counts with a National representative on the INSPIRE expert group, Alexandra Fonseca (PhD).
Primary Business Mapping, Photogrammetry, Remote Sensing, Standardisation. 
Environmental application domains Spatial Planning, Monitoring Urban Sprawl, Rural Development, Man-made and Natural Hazard Management, Forest Fire Prevention and Management
